
Women's Tennis Loses To Indiana, 7-0
January 24, 2010 | Women's Tennis
MUNCIE, Ind. - The Ball State University women's tennis team lost its first match of the season after starting 2010 off with a 2-0 record after suffering a 7-0 loss to Big Ten foe Indiana Saturday night at the Muncie Northwest YMCA Tennis Center.
The Cardinals fell behind early to the Hoosiers after dropping the doubles point. In singles action Ball State fell in straight sets.
The Ball State University women's tennis team will remain at home on Wednesday when it hosts IUPUI beginning at 2 p.m.
